The Boeing 777-300ER is one of the world's most advanced and efficient long-haul passenger aircraft. Manufactured by Boeing Commercial Airplanes, the aircraft is renowned for its exceptional range, fuel efficiency, and passenger comfort. American Airlines operates the Boeing 777-300ER on many of its flagship international routes connecting North America with Europe, South America, Asia, and the Middle East. Powered by two General Electric GE90-115B turbofan enginesthe most powerful commercial jet engines ever builtthe aircraft produces over 115,000 pounds of thrust per engine, delivering remarkable performance during takeoff. The 777-300ER typically accommodates 304 passengers in American Airlines' three-class configuration and can fly more than 13,600 kilometers (8,450 miles) nonstop.

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W) is one of the busiest airports in the world and serves as the primary hub for American Airlines. Opened in 1974, DFW covers approximately 17,000 acres, making it one of the largest airports by land area. The airport connects more than 250 destinations across six continents and handles tens of millions of passengers every year. Located between the cities of Dallas and Fort Worth in Texas, DFW plays a vital role in global aviation and is a paradise for aviation photographers and plane spotters thanks to its multiple runways and excellent viewing locations such as Founder's Plaza.
